# Solar Powered Systems 

Off-grid and hybrid solar energy solutions that power water pumps and treatment plants — reducing costs and eliminating grid dependency across South Africa.

## Harness the Sun to Power Your Water

Reduce energy costs and eliminate grid dependency with our solar-powered pumping and treatment systems. Designed for remote sites and off-grid applications, our solar solutions ensure uninterrupted water supply while cutting operational expenses by up to 90%.

From solar panel array design through to battery storage, inverter installation, and smart monitoring — we deliver complete, turnkey solar water systems that pay for themselves within 3–5 years.

Our Process

### From Sunlight to Water Flow

A complete solar water solution — from energy assessment to long-term monitoring.

01 

### Energy Assessment

We analyse your site's solar irradiance, water demand, and pumping requirements to size the optimal solar array and storage system.

02 

### Solar Array Design

Custom panel layout and mounting design to maximise energy capture, accounting for orientation, shading, and seasonal variation.

03 

### Battery & Inverter

Specification and installation of battery banks and inverters for energy storage, ensuring continuous operation during cloudy periods and at night.

04 

### Pump Integration

Direct coupling of solar power to submersible pumps, booster systems, or treatment plants — with intelligent load management.

05 

### Remote Monitoring

Cloud-connected monitoring systems that track energy generation, pump performance, and system health in real time from any device.

06 

### Maintenance & Support

Scheduled panel cleaning, inverter servicing, battery health checks, and 24/7 technical support to maximise system lifespan.
